VPD Arrests, Nov. 23 to 30

The following arrest information was supplied by the Vienna Police Department. It does not indicate a conviction.

Three people were arrested by the Vienna Police Department between Nov. 23 and 30.

  • During a traffic stop at 1:49 p.m. Nov. 24 on Maple Avenue, an officer learned the driver was wanted by the state of Florida. Police arrested John Phillip Stevenson, 40, of Leesburg, as a Fugitive from Justice based on the original charge for Felony Bad Check in Florida. Stevenson was held without bond at the Fairfax County Adult Detention Center.
  • During a traffic stop at 12:38 a.m. Nov. 27 near Lawyers Road and Upham Place NW, an officer noticed a driver showed signs of impairment. After failing to complete several field sobriety tests, Mark Alden Waldrop, 21, of Mineral, Va. was arrested for driving while intoxicated. Waldrop was taken to the Vienna Police Station for a breath analysis, and then to the Fairfax County Adult Detention Center where he was formally charged. He was held on a $1,500.00 bond.
  • During a traffic stop at 1:34 a.m. Nov. 29, police noticed the driver was impaired. After failing to complete several field sobriety tests, Patricia Lynn Deleon, 48, of Vienna, was arrested for driving while intoxicated.
    Deleon was as taken to the Vienna Police Station for a breath analysis, and then to the Fairfax County Adult Detention Center where she was formally charged. She was held on a $2,00.00 bond.
